Transaction eda33016b86efa93d9b772a45b21606c497b1c7b7084103b6346aaeb54a64339
1 Input
1 Output
-
eda33016b86efa93d9b772a45b21606c497b1c7b7084103b6346aaeb54a64339:0
- value
- 99743500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 688710d371b9ef19e761c0db5ee13b6a48df4d22 OP_EQUAL
- address
- 3BDi12RPdspbYtSBr39cSAopt5T8nrt2Jx